Welcome to Udaipur! Start your family-friendly adventure by checking into your hotel and taking some time to relax and settle in. In the afternoon, head to Fateh Sagar Lake, a picturesque artificial lake known for its tranquil surroundings. Take a boat ride and soak in the stunning views of the surrounding hills and palaces. In the evening, visit the Bagore Ki Haveli, a historic mansion known for its cultural performances, folk dances, and puppet shows.
Start your day by visiting the City Palace, a magnificent palace complex showcasing the grandeur of Rajput architecture. Explore the various palaces, courtyards, and museums within the complex. In the afternoon, head to Saheliyon Ki Bari, a beautiful garden adorned with fountains, kiosks, marble elephants, and a delightful lotus pool. Conclude your day by enjoying a serene boat ride on Lake Pichola, where you can admire the stunning Jag Mandir and Lake Palace.
Begin your day by visiting the Vintage & Classic Car Museum, which showcases a fascinating collection of vintage cars and royal carriages. Next, immerse yourself in the artistic culture of Udaipur by visiting the Shilpgram Crafts Village, where you can witness traditional Rajasthani arts and crafts being created. In the afternoon, explore the Sajjangarh Monsoon Palace, perched on a hilltop and offering panoramic views of Udaipur. Wrap up your day by watching a mesmerizing cultural dance performance at the Bagore Ki Haveli.
On your last day in Udaipur, embark on an exciting adventure to the Sajjangarh Wildlife Sanctuary, located near the Monsoon Palace. Explore the sanctuary's diverse flora and fauna, including deer, leopards, and a variety of bird species. In the afternoon, visit the beautiful Gulab Bagh and Zoo, a lush garden housing a zoo with various animals and a toy train for children. End your trip by indulging in some souvenir shopping at the vibrant local markets.
For a unique and off the beaten path experience, visit the Shri Ekling Ji Temple, located about 21 kilometers from Udaipur. This ancient temple is dedicated to Lord Shiva and is known for its intricate architecture and spiritual ambience. Another hidden gem is the Ahar Cenotaphs, a collection of royal cenotaphs and memorials showcasing the rich history of the Mewar dynasty. Take a leisurely stroll through these serene surroundings and admire the intricate carvings and craftsmanship.
